About
Proton is a Swiss technology company building a privacy-first ecosystem of products. Founded in 2014 by scientists who met at CERN and headquartered in Geneva, Proton is majority owned by the non-profit Proton Foundation. The suite includes Proton Mail (the world's largest encrypted email service), Proton VPN, Proton Drive, Proton Calendar, Proton Pass, and Proton Authenticator.
All Proton clients are open source under GPLv3. The company was initially crowdfunded on Indiegogo and has grown to offices in Geneva, Zurich, Paris, London, Barcelona, Skopje, Vilnius, Prague, and Taipei.
The engineering stack includes Rust (cross-platform shared business logic), React and TypeScript (web), Go (backend), SwiftUI (iOS), and Jetpack Compose (Android), with deep expertise in end-to-end encryption and zero-access architecture.
